Steve’s story: Understanding hospital detention
Steve was detained under the Mental Health Act after a crisis. He and his family didn’t understand what was happening or what his rights were.
An independent advocate explained the detention process, ensured Steve knew his rights, and spoke up for him in meetings.

Priya’s story: Planning for dementia care
When Priya’s mum was diagnosed with early dementia, Priya felt overwhelmed trying to support her and ensure her wishes were respected.
An advocate explained the types of Lasting Power of Attorney (LPA) and helped Priya plan ahead with her mum.

James’s story: Navigating care home decisions
James’s brother, who has a learning disability, was placed in a care home under the Deprivation of Liberty Safeguards (DoLS). James felt excluded and confused.
An advocate clarified DoLS and supported James in sharing his concerns, leading to a review and better communication.

Amina’s story: Returning home after 20 Years
Amina had lived in care homes for over two decades. She wanted to move back in with her elderly parents to support each other.
With help from an advocate, Amina took her case to the Court of Protection and successfully reunited with her family.

Daniel’s story: Being involved in his care
After a brain injury, Daniel struggled with memory and decision-making. He worried his care plan wouldn’t reflect his true needs.
An independent advocate helped Daniel prepare for his Care Act assessment and ensured his voice was heard.
